Received: by 2002:a25:1506:0:0:0:0:0 with SMTP id 6csp2389737ybv; Mon, 24 Feb 2020 04:28:19 -0800 (PST) X-Google-Smtp-Source: APXvYqy+5jRXr3EJ5rgkbT2nLNRwLotK7xZFvPl6VkOWxhu52buf95T+/tLnY4mBDZ1atbnqqDWy X-Received: by 2002:a9d:7548:: with SMTP id b8mr41316272otl.74.1582547299013; Mon, 24 Feb 2020 04:28:19 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1582547299; cv=none; d=google.com; s=arc-20160816; b=dLYB2fg7izU2pzrJsTJwWvIK90Er8+1QOoZl4ik4MsmRur79KTT7q/JhlN0ClhMBUd KrAoeKyImKMEbjrws3nliYf2ozQd3SSOK6CzdyLX5X94YnVagCP4N35N19fWINT8ObJg wsAtHqUBAV/QoT316RA8X8W/Qc9DfyCNUhfksN4oMwig5ToMgiJ8MIhWwFwFtiVj1PF6 4zNqI1tiBfmsFKOCFJNCbJCwhpITbk6I4M6G8m0Y3rd2kxFT3ZuF7ema8YJhEYorZ3zr u1cwIDQa3GfbJDX/6gwDkhLSytidB7Hgzeb8sdObWC8d3U2CpJbudO2md1Fte1YKo9fV D8+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:content-transfer-encoding:mime-version :user-agent:references:in-reply-to:date:cc:to:from:subject :message-id; bh=jmSvjBymsQt2nSZ3KjPLyr9IuKYYJhUjeQVjcqUB8L8=; b=witicUXEHKQfZw8GrYbPPUefjHJ14TMRTmoKCK5/8efBgP8mfG2R7w350aI7OixlZR qkVT92g7S4QkZ4Ekws1Zl9ObjJO/ctILzwVh6yqTV+iU1zfiTahNKCretJrw3dBDT5HQ 9sbjnQwCGKMvJiTIE1eSapXMQM7LwPJwUWQn7vbrhk9rhGC231n6tgYeiHJOq4rXOFtI RGqFyGQM0NtA97OkXxfB2Nq+SfLUUuDKaH8bQ2keIoHpzo48ERLDXlDHIT1PXO4BUGek rXQ5eq31ESGlmtPy05b3iVK2wO5z4ZcTIsX0FFVxyn95Ulm3AaBNdAu2Hl9G7bY4De0W xBIg==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-wireless-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-wireless-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id p1si6327031otk.42.2020.02.24.04.28.06; Mon, 24 Feb 2020 04:28:19 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-wireless-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-wireless-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-wireless-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1727281AbgBXM1s (ORCPT + 99 others); Mon, 24 Feb 2020 07:27:48 -0500 Received: from s3.sipsolutions.net ([144.76.43.62]:32944 "EHLO sipsolutions.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726778AbgBXM1r (ORCPT ); Mon, 24 Feb 2020 07:27:47 -0500 Received: by sipsolutions.net with esmtpsa (TLS1.3:ECDHE_SECP256R1__RSA_PSS_RSAE_SHA256__AES_256_GCM:256) (Exim 4.93) (envelope-from ) id 1j6Cpu-006YqF-Be; Mon, 24 Feb 2020 13:27:46 +0100 Message-ID: <4b0d571a735f9b868ddef6054c714deb5fcad50f.camel@sipsolutions.net> Subject: Re: [PATCH] mac80211: only send control port frames over nl80211 control port From: Johannes Berg To: Markus Theil Cc: linux-wireless@vger.kernel.org Date: Mon, 24 Feb 2020 13:27:45 +0100 In-Reply-To: <20200224121954.66739-1-markus.theil@tu-ilmenau.de> References: <20200224121954.66739-1-markus.theil@tu-ilmenau.de> Content-Type: text/plain; charset="UTF-8" User-Agent: Evolution 3.34.2 (3.34.2-1.fc31) MIME-Version: 1.0 Content-Transfer-Encoding: 7bit Sender: linux-wireless-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-wireless@vger.kernel.org On Mon, 2020-02-24 at 13:19 +0100, Markus Theil wrote: > As Jouni recently pointed out, the nl80211 control should only transmit > and receive EAPOL frames. This patch removes forwarding of > preauthentication frames over the control port. They are handled as > ordinary data frames again. Yeah, we need to do something like this, but this will break iwd as it relies on this RX path when the feature flag is set. johannes